Wansei Recycling Systems Co., Ltd. Business Introduction

We are contributing to the preservation of the global environment by recycling waste into raw materials and fuel.

Wansei Recycling Systems Co., Ltd. is a company that collects various types of waste from waste generators and recycles them into raw materials and fuels such as wood chips and fluff fuel as much as possible. We provide these materials to paper manufacturers and power companies through maritime and land transportation.
